A Visual Style That Commands Attention
Much of Montroso’s recognition comes from his ability to tell stories visually. His artwork is both bold and intricate, combining vibrant color palettes with textured patterns and symbolic imagery. Observers often describe his pieces as emotionally charged, as if each stroke of paint or line of ink carries personal significance.
Several characteristics define his style:
- Color as Emotion: Montroso uses bright reds, deep blues, and earthy tones to convey cultural identity and emotional depth.
- Symbolic Layering: His works often contain small symbolic elements—birds, hands, maize, woven patterns—that hint at deeper narratives.
- Urban Influence: While rooted in tradition, his style includes modern urban elements such as graffiti textures and abstract strokes.
- Narrative Focus: Each piece tells a story, whether it’s about migration, family, resilience, or self-discovery.
This unique style has made him a favorite in galleries, community exhibitions, and digital art spaces. His work resonates with audiences because it feels both global and local—something familiar yet entirely his own.
